Cardi B Hopes Her Next Collaboration With Offset Is “Freaky” Love Song

Cardi B wants to make a sexually charged song with Offset. The Atlantic Records rapper revealed her desire to create a “freaky” record with her husband in an interview with SiriusXM’s Hip Hop Nation.


“I do wanna do more songs with him,” Cardi B told host Swaggy Sie. “I do wanna explore. I feel like we do so much rough songs and it’s like, let’s talk about f######. It’s like we always talk about the music. Let’s talk about f###### because I feel like we always like on attack mode when we do songs together. Let’s do a little something, something – freaky, freaky, freaky, freaky.”



Cardi B said she and Offset only recorded five songs together. The couple’s collaborations typically develop from their mutual interest in a track.

“He usually just have a song and I be like, ‘I like this song. I want to get on this song because I like this song,’” Cardi B explained. “But even with ‘Jealousy’ and everything, when I first did it, I was like, ‘I feel like I don’t sound too strong.’ He’s like, ‘Yeah, your voice is a little bit like, why you putting that girly sound on it?’ Because I change my voice when I rap … He was like, ‘You need to go like more tough,’ and it’s like, ‘What you said right there?’ I said this. He was like, ‘You gotta pronounce it better.’ We critique each other a lot.”

Cardi B stopped by the SiriusXM studios to promote her new single “Bongos” featuring Megan Thee Stallion. The track was their first collaboration since the smash hit “WAP.”
